How to Make a Sad Lion

Hey folks! I've been finishing up my cowardly lion mold from last semester these past few weeks. First I made a lion out of sculpey (based off my cowardly lion illustration from last year). Then I made a mold from that sculpey figure out of silicone. This mold annihilated my original sculpey figure, so I don't have any pictures of that to show you... fortunately the mold yielded a nice batch of resin copies. :) This is my first time making a mold and resin copies... it was super fun and I totally want to do it again and again.
